More about Banjo

Meet Banjo! Banjo is a 6-year-old Husky/Border Collie mix with striking looks and a big personality. Weighing around 60 lbs and neutered, Banjo loves human attention and thrives on affection. He’s smart, loyal, and has that wonderful mix of Husky confidence and Collie heart. Banjo would do best in a home without small dogs or young kids, but he’s more than ready to be someone’s devoted adventure buddy. He’d love a secure yard, daily walks, and lots of love from his person. Banjo’s brother, Butterball, is also available for adoption — they adore each other but can be adopted separately.
